#2c0c16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c0c16 is composed of 17.3% red, 4.7%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.7% magenta, 50% yellow and 82.7% black. It has a hue angle of 341.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 11%. #2c0c16 color hex could be obtained by blending #58182c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#2c0c16 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c0c16 has RGB values of R:44, G:12,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.5, K:0.83. Its decimal value is 2886678.

Shades and Tints of #2c0c16
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0407 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c0c16
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1d1b1c is the less saturated color, while #370112 is the most saturated one.
